For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 81 students in Lamoni Community School District. This district's average high testing ranking is 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public high schools in Iowa.
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ø High School in Lamoni Community School District have an average math proficiency score of 57% (versus the Iowa public high school average of 65%), and reading proficiency score of 72% (versus the 71% statewide average).
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ø High School in Lamoni Community School District have a Graduation Rate of 80%, which is less than the Iowa average of 87%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Lamoni High School, with ≥80%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Iowa or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 14%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Iowa public high school average of 27%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$17,775 is higher than the state median of $16,468.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$14,848 is less than the state median of $16,042.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
